On Jan 31, 2005, at 9:12 AM, MIKE GREENWAY wrote:

> I have read  here before on the reaction of putting copper to 
> galvanized
> metal causes a bad reaction.  There were suggestions of putting 
> stainless
> steel sheets between the galvanized leg and copper.  Are there any 
> fixtures
> that bolt to galvanized legs that have little reaction and allow the 
> copper
> ground wire to be connected to the fixture?

Mike,

I used stainless steel hose clamps and a little 1" square of stainless 
steel. The square goes between the copper and the tower leg. Tighten it 
down and you're done.

Cheap and effective.
